Arsenal transfer news – Ferdi Kadıoğlu
According to a report from Turkish outlet Sabah earlier this week, the north Londoners are preparing to travel to Turkey next week in order to sign Fenerbahçe left-back Ferdi Kadıoğlu.
The Turkish side currently values the defender at €30m (£24m) and, given just how light Arsenal are in this area, with Oleksandr Zinchenko the only senior left-back in the squad, it could represent decent business.
The Dutch-born Turkish international is only 24 and not only could he add much-needed competition, but he could even be an upgrade on Zinchenko.
Ferdi Kadıoğlu could be an upgrade on Oleksandr Zinchenko
Not only has Kadıoğlu registered a higher shots on target percentage domestically this season (28.6% vs 15.4%) than Zinchenko, but he has also registered more crosses (40 vs 24) and this indicates that he could be a much better-attacking option than the Ukrainian player.
The Turkish defender has also created more big chances (five vs three) and has averaged more key passes per game (1.6 vs 1.1) which is further evidence that he is a greater threat further up the field.
Kadıoğlu has kept eight clean sheets in the league this term, along with making 0.9 interceptions per game and winning 6.3 total duels per game. Over the same metrics, Zinchenko has kept just two clean sheets, made 0.7 interceptions per game and won 3.9 total duels each match, suggesting that the Fenerbahçe defender could even be an upgrade defensively.
Throughout the course of his career, the Ukrainian full-back has scored just six goals and registered 23 assists, taking 233 matches to achieve this.
On the other hand, Kadıoğlu has found the back of the net 28 times and grabbed a further 36 assists across 242 matches and if Arteta is looking for more goal contributions to come from his fullbacks, making a move for the Turkish international is a no-brainer.
